(Serves 8) Its cups (1 can) sweetened condensed milk 4 cup lemon juice cup canned sliced peaches (well di ained) 2 egg whites (stiffly beaten) 2t chocolate wafers Blend sweetened condensed milk and lemon juica thoroughly. Stir until mixture thickens. Add shred poaches, which have been well drained. Beat egg whites until stiff and fold into mixture. Line narrow oblong pan with wax paper. Cover with fruit mixture. Add layer of wafers, alternating with the fruit mixture, (hushing with a layer of wafers Chill In refrigerator 8 hours, or longer. To serve, turn out on small platter and carefully remove wax paper. Cut in slices, and serve plain or with whipped cream. If you are abreast with the times in matter of modern fashion parlance, "dinner shirt" is exactly what you will call the new dressy blouse shown here which can be worn to informal dine and dance parties. This attractive dinner shirt with waistband and pleated front is fashioned of silk triple sheer. It is a very much affair. It takes on a accent across its yoke where a horizontal floral motif ia done in sparkle-sparklpaillettes and tiny beads. Dude Ranch Clothes Add Dash' to Sports JTear proud Old Chinese Costumes te e Pi South American costumes are in spiration for modern clothe. The vidid colors and startling combinations of color sound a gay note ia contrast to the vogue for black that ha prevailed so long and is still holding its own. The South American trends also make lavish use of braids, embroideries and fringe. Campus girls are thrilled with the Idea of dude ranch clothes for sport wear. They especially like plaid flanael ihirts. studded belts and triage uhs for roughirg it and the latest ia to wear riding boots to replace galoshea Fashion is In a mood for borrowing ideas from the rich costumes of Chinese origin. Mandarin Kmies, dragons embroidered on yellow wool dresses, sleek straight silhouettes, pompadours laequered smooth and high, chrysanthemums for coiffure adornment, all of which are entering the winter fashion picture.
